Xiude Fan is a scholar working on Epidemiology, Molecular Biology and Hepatology. According to data from OpenAlex, Xiude Fan has authored 84 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 36 papers in Epidemiology, 20 papers in Molecular Biology and 18 papers in Hepatology. Recurrent topics in Xiude Fan’s work include Liver Disease Diagnosis and Treatment (26 papers), Hepatitis B Virus Studies (11 papers) and Hepatitis C virus research (8 papers). Xiude Fan is often cited by papers focused on Liver Disease Diagnosis and Treatment (26 papers), Hepatitis B Virus Studies (11 papers) and Hepatitis C virus research (8 papers). Xiude Fan collaborates with scholars based in China, United States and Iran. Xiude Fan's co-authors include Qunying Han, Zhengwen Liu, Xiaoge Zhang, Na Li, Xiaoqin Wu, Huan Deng, Yi Lv, Tatsunori Miyata, Laura E. Nagy and Xiqiang Wang and has published in prestigious journals such as Annals of Internal Medicine, Gastroenterology and PLoS ONE.
